How they compare
Niger currently reports 5 against 5 in Uganda, a difference of 0.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 53 shared years of data; in 1972 it was Uganda ahead.
Niger ranks 41st and Uganda ranks 41st of 198 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Niger averaged higher in 2 and Uganda in 4.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Niger | Uganda |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 6 | 6.88 | 0.875 | Uganda |
| 1980s | 6 | 4.44 | 1.56 | Niger |
| 1990s | 4.8 | 4.7 | 0.1 | Niger |
| 2000s | 3.7 | 4.2 | 0.5 | Uganda |
| 2010s | 4 | 4.5 | 0.5 | Uganda |
| 2020s | 4.33 | 5 | 0.6667 | Uganda |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Identifies the extent of freedom of expression and association, the rule of law, and personal autonomy. Lower ratings indicate more liberties.
